After telling my sensei’s wife that I wasn’t up for the gig, I got to thinking – How long would it take this guitar player/bizdev guy to re-create a web site using WordPress? I decided to find out.
We started with this site: http://martialartslv.com
The goal was to use as much of their content as possible, not adding any bells and whistles, but clean the site up a little bit, get some data capture happening, make it a bit more user friendly and maybe get some very basic SEO and a site map going.
Total time to complete: 64 minutes. Here’s the timeline:
